On our way back from Cape Town we have an overnight stay in Johannesburg. Exhausted after our early morning flight, we can’t resist taking the rest of the day to see our surroundings.
Apartheid Museum
From the moment we enter the building, facts surrounding this dark period of South Africa are outlined in a well presented way with scripts and incredible photos.
Nelson Mandela
The exhibition on Mandela is both uplifting and saddening. A description of his history, political beginning and his time in prison.

Witch Doctor Shop
This was the fun part seeing African Traditional Medicine. All new to us. We were told some illnesses are caused by witchcraft or through neglect of the ancestors. Yikes!!
